Ukko-Pekka Luukkonen on fire! Selected as the top star in the NHL
Buffalo Sabres continued their strong run in the NHL last night. This time Buffalo defeated the Montreal Canadiens 4-2.
The victory did not come easily. Montreal was in control of the game and won the shots 34-17. Ukko-Pekka Luukkonen’s strong goaltending, however, helped Buffalo turn the game into a win. The Finnish goalie had a save percentage of 94.10 in the game. Luukkonen was named the first star of the match.
Also, Buffalo’s Finnish prospect Konsta Helenius had a strong game. His line was the best in terms of scoring chances for Buffalo, and Helenius recorded an assist on the winning goal.
After 20 games played, Luukkonen’s save percentage is 90.5. Helenius, on the other hand, has scored 1+3=4 points in three NHL games.
With their strong form, Buffalo has taken a solid grip on a playoff spot. The team has 61 points after 50 games played. The Toronto Maple Leafs, chasing a playoff spot, also have 50 games played but only 57 points.
